Brother
Cha:dy
WE SAY
We’ve been following the talented Parisian alt-jazz singer-songwriter Cha:dy for three years now and have previously featured her gorgeous track Lazy back in February and the slick, alt R&B jammer Like A Boi in 2018. Now she is back with her finest yet, this powerful and thought-provoking number that addresses the pain, history and the events that led to the BLM movement last year. Released last week, Brother is a beautifully composed and orchestrated track with soft, rich melodies, sweeping strings, and lush percussive elements. Brother received its premiere on Complex yesterday, and we reckon this will be the first of many more features and playlist additions over the coming days. Much like Celeste and Amy Winehouse, Cha:dy’s velvety yet raspy vocals are a bewitching listen and one we can quite happily go back to listen to again and again. Marvellous.
